Factors to Consider When Selecting Poop Bags for Different Dog Sizes

How to Choose the Best Personalized Poop Bags for Your Dog's Needs

When choosing personalized poop bags for your dog, it’s essential to consider the size of your furry friend, as different breeds have varying waste disposal needs. Smaller dogs, such as Chihuahuas or Dachshunds, typically produce less waste, which means you can opt for thinner, lightweight bags that are easy to carry and handle. For larger breeds like Golden Retrievers or Great Danes, it's crucial to select sturdy, extra-large bags that can accommodate more waste without the risk of tearing.

Tips: Always check the bag's strength and durability to avoid any unfortunate spills during walks. Look for bags that are made from environmentally-friendly materials as they are gentler on the planet while still providing adequate waste containment.

Additionally, consider the bag's design features. Some poop bags come with easy-tear perforations that allow for quick and efficient use, which is particularly beneficial for busy owners who are always on the go. If you frequently walk your dog in public parks or busy areas, bags with added scent control can help mitigate unpleasant odors.

Tips: Opt for roll dispensers that can conveniently attach to your dog's leash for hassle-free access. It's also wise to choose bags that fit well in your pocket or bag, ensuring you're always prepared.

Evaluating Biodegradable vs. Non-Biodegradable Poop Bags: An Overview

When choosing poop bags for your dog, one of the significant distinctions to consider is between biodegradable and non-biodegradable options. Biodegradable poop bags are designed to break down over time, making them a more environmentally friendly choice. These bags are often made from materials like corn starch or other plant-based substances, which can decompose under the right conditions. On the other hand, non-biodegradable bags, typically made from plastic, can linger in landfills for hundreds of years, contributing to environmental pollution.

Tips for selecting the right type of bag for your dog include assessing your lifestyle and commitment to sustainability. If you often walk your dog in areas with waste disposal bins that are regularly serviced, non-biodegradable options might be sufficient. However, if you are environmentally conscious and want to reduce your carbon footprint, biodegradable bags are the way to go, provided you are aware of how to properly dispose of them to ensure they break down effectively.

It's also crucial to consider the durability of the bags. No one wants a bag that tears or leaks! Look for heavy-duty biodegradable bags if you opt for that option; they should be sturdy enough to handle your dog’s waste without any worry. Ultimately, the best choice for your furry friend will hinge on balancing environmental concerns with functionality and convenience. Remember to always dispose of waste responsibly, regardless of the bag type selected.
